Subtask 20-23-11-210-058-A
A. Visual Inspection Before Assembly
(1) Make sure that the parts you assemble are clean and free of contamination.
(2) Make sure that the parts you assemble are not damaged. Specially, examine the sealing surfaces (on fittings and pipe ends) and the threads of the fittings.
4. Procedure(1) Make sure that the parts you assemble are clean and free of contamination.
(2) Make sure that the parts you assemble are not damaged. Specially, examine the sealing surfaces (on fittings and pipe ends) and the threads of the fittings.
NOTE: Reject any part that shows signs of damage (scratches, nicks, deformation...).
Subtask 20-23-11-917-082-A
CAUTION:
ONLY USE THE SPECIFIED LUBRICANT TO LUBRICATE THE FITTING THREADS AND THE SHOULDER OF THE SLEEVE.
CAUTION:
ONLY USE HYDRAULIC FLUID MATERIAL NO. 02ABA1 TO LUBRICATE THE THREAD OF THE HOUSING. OTHER LUBRICANTS CAN CAUSE DAMAGE TO THE O-RING.
A. Lubrication (1) For the pipe connection (union, nut and sleeve):
Lubricate with Phosphate Ester Hydraulic Fluid-General Power - - (Material No.02ABA1) or Grease-Hydraulic Systems - - (Material No.03LDA1) on the areas as follows:
- The thread of the union
- The rear of the sleeve collar.
NOTE: It is not permitted to apply lubricant on the thread of the nut and on the contact surfaces between the sleeve and the union.
(2) For the plug in component (housing side only):Lubricate only the thread of the housing with Phosphate Ester Hydraulic Fluid-General Power - - (Material No.02ABA1) .
Do not lubricate the external thread of the plug-in component (O-ring side) because the lubricant can push out the O-ring from the plug-in component during the assembly.
Apply lubrication principle for the related coupling type on the opposite side connection of the housing.
(3) For the external-swaged pipe couplings with the swivel nut or the hose end fittings with the nut:
Lubricate with Phosphate Ester Hydraulic Fluid-General Power - - (Material No.02ABA1) or Grease-Hydraulic Systems - - (Material No.03LDA1) on the areas as follows:
- The thread of the union only
- The wire from the back of the nut. Then turn the nut to make sure that the complete wire is correctly lubricated.
NOTE: It is not permitted to apply lubricant on the thread of the nut and on the contact surfaces between the sleeve and the union.
(4) Remove the unwanted lubricant with a clean, dry Textile-Lint free Cotton - (Material No.14SBA1) . B. Assembly

Subtask 20-23-11-917-084-A NOTE: Connection on straight plug-in components or bulkhead fittings:
(1) Put the pipe in position and make sure that: - Straight plug-in components.
You must install and torque the straight plug-in component to the applicable torque value before you connect the pipe (Ref. AMM TASK 20-29-00-911-002). - Straight bulkhead fittings.
You must install the straight bulkhead fittings and torque the locknut to the applicable value before you connect the pipe. - Swivel bulkhead fittings.
You must connect and torque the pipe sleeve nuts (at each end of the fitting) to the applicable value before you torque the locknut of the swivel bulkhead fitting to the applicable value.
- the pipe you install is not too short or too long
- the pipe you install can be put in position without too much force on the clamp blocks
- the pipe is correctly aligned at unions.
NOTE: The force necessary to correctly align the pipe must not be more than light finger pressure ( 1 daN (2.2481 lbf)).
(2) Align the pipe and the fitting and engage tube end. The sleeve must fully touch the mating surface of the fitting. (3) Tighten the sleeve nut with your hand until it touches sleeve shoulder.
NOTE: The nut must turn freely on the thread. This shows that the tube ends are correctly aligned.
NOTE: You must connect and tighten with your hand all the ends of the pipe before you apply the tightening torque on one end.
NOTE: When you install a pipe on a tee or a cross, you must connect and tighten with your hand all the connections of the tee or the cross before you apply the tightening torque on one end.
NOTE: When you connect a flexible hose, make sure that you do not twist the hose during the assembly.

5. Close-upCAUTION:
WHEN YOU TORQUE THE NUT, ALWAYS USE A SECOND WRENCH TO APPLY A COUNTERTORQUE TO THE FITTING.
(1) Find the correct torque value (Ref. AMM TASK 20-21-12-911-001). NOTE: To find the correct torque value, you must know the material and the dimension of the parts you assemble.
If the connection has different materials, you must use the torque value for the weakest material.
(2) Get the applicable torque wrench and the applicable wrench adapter for the nut and an applicable second wrench to apply the countertorque to the fitting. If the connection has different materials, you must use the torque value for the weakest material.
We recommend the tools from the 98F29003000000 WRENCHES-STANDARD TORQUE SET.
(3) Set the torque wrench to the applicable value.
When you use a wrench adapter, you must adjust the value.
(4) Put the torque wrench in position on the sleeve nut and the countertorque wrench in position on the fitting.
NOTE: We recommend that you install the wrench adapter in the same axis as the torque wrench.
NOTE: The torque wrench must always be installed on the nut (female part) and the countertorque wrench on the fitting (male part).
(5) Apply a slow and continuous force on the torque wrench until you have the set torque value. NOTE: Always pull (or push) at right angles to the handle of the torque wrench.
Try to apply load to the center of the hand grip of the torque wrench.
Pull with fingers only. Do not hold the hand grip.
(6) Double tightening torque Try to apply load to the center of the hand grip of the torque wrench.
Pull with fingers only. Do not hold the hand grip.
NOTE: The double tightening torque is not applicable for the installation of the plug-in components installed with an O-ring (for example, plug-in unions, manifold plugs and plug-in check-valves).
(a) Torque the union: - torque the nut to the correct value
- loosen the nut by one turn
- torque the nut again to the correct value.
